    4, THORNTON STREET, BARROW-UPON-HUMBER, DN19 7DG

    This semi-detached freehold property on Thornton Street last sold in March 2014 for £160,000. Based on price growth in the DN19 district since then, its estimated current value is £237,948 — placing it in the 34th percentile nationally and the 49th percentile within DN19. The property covers 96 m² (1,033 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,479 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— DN19

    DN19 covers the market towns and rural areas of north Lincolnshire, situated in the East Midlands between the Humber and the Wolds. It is a quieter, more established residential area with a focus on owner-occupied family homes and traditional community appeal.
